2010 RAM 1500 Auto Transmission
New guy here!
I just purchased a 2010 Ram 1500 Crew Cab, STL, 4.7L. Love the tuck, but the transmission has me concerned. Shifting up (in D) is fine, down shifting (leaving it in D) feels like I am manually doing it. Seems like from 3rd to 2nd or 2nd to 1st. The tach actually jumps about 500 RPM's!
Took it to dealer - they reset the computer said to drive it like hell - because the transmission/computer has a memory - driving habits, etc.... Service Manager said I was babying it. If there is a Dodge Mechanic out there that would confirm or deny please let me know.
Do they all down shift like this? I have 2005 Durango and have never had problems with this. Stumped... help!

Well, in factory form, they do like to downshift pretty aggressively. Some like it, some do not. Matter of preference. If you want to get rid of this feeling, then I suggest you get a tuning solution such as Diablo or SuperChips and adjust your transmission that way. I do not know what kind of support that those two have for the 4.7 at this current time though.
All in all, it is a normal part of the downshift schedule.
